Virtual reality is about an entirely interactive digital environment, while augmented reality incorporates enhanced virtual objects superimposed in the real-world environment. And these computer-generated virtual objects can be rendered in numerous formats, like images, videos, or interactive data. These technologies are together known as Extended Reality (XR).

Here are four significant AR-VR trends revolutionizing businesses:
Healthcare
Doctors will understand which procedures are ideally suited to using these AR and VR technologies. For example, psychiatrists are now performing Virtual Reality Immersion Therapy to treat people with PTSD and anxiety disorders.
Through biosensors coupled with VR, they can better understand how their patients react to stressful scenarios. VR is also utilized to help autistic people develop social and communication skills. Patients can also find visual impairments by monitoring eye movements. AR is also employed to train medical management in to learn surgical skills on digitally simulated models.
Industries
VR can be utilized to experience working in hazardous conditions or with costly, easily damaged tools and equipment without danger in the industrial landscape. This eradicates the risks of hazards and damage associated with using the assembly line.
On the contrary, AR can help manage inventory databases and build and refine prototypes' visual representations until they enter the prototype phase. They also reduce costs. With quicker data processing, real-time analytics, and power sensors, it can be sure that the scope of AR-VR can increase dramatically.
Headsets
One of the great challenges in VR technology was bulky, uncomfortable, wired headsets and display units. But some alterations have also been made here. For example, we now have customizable, smaller systems with a broader view and higher resolution displays for VR-AR headsets.
5G
5G will remodel and adopt the XR industry despite its sluggish roll-out in the early years. Gratitude to its hyper-mobile networking speed, the data broadcast rate to the cloud, its processing, and the delivery of an actionable output would also be quicker. This will lead to a zero-lag environment that will result in seamless streaming of information from the cloud. This would also lessen reliance on wired networks and onboard hardware as end data centers process visual feedback within a few seconds.
